Robust unified $H_\infty$ dynamic observer design for uncertain systems
Résumé
In this paper, a new robust unified $H_\infty$ dynamic observer (UDO) design for systems in the presence of time-varying uncertainty and disturbances is presented. The observer design method is derived from the solution of the liner matrix inequality (LMI), based on the solution of the algebraic constraint obtained from the analysis of the estimation error. A numerical example is presented to show the performance of the proposed observer
